1. What is a half-moon mark?

A white arc-shaped mark appears at the bottom fifth of the nail. This is the half-moon mark, also known as the little sun. The condition of the half-moon mark shows information about the human body's health status, so it is also called the health circle.

The growth of the half-moon marks is affected by changes in nutritional status and physical fitness. When the digestion and absorption function is poor, or the physical fitness declines, the half-moon marks will blur, decrease, or even disappear.
